Job Summary
This role will serve as a subject matter expert (SME) for the F&G Cayman Re financial reporting and analysis process. This individual will be responsible for oversight, analysis and continuous improvement of the processes that generate financial reporting and analysis for the FG Cayman Re business. This reporting includes standard US Stat and GAAP presentations, Cayman Islands regulatory bases and additional views used for internal management information. This individual will collaborate closely with F&G’s Financial Reporting and Reinsurance teams to drive timely and accurate delivery of a variety of financial analyses, controlling the flow of information and tracking issues, changes and notable items. This individual will also lead the development, creation, implementation and consistent execution of an evolving set of business-appropriate analyses supporting summarization of key drivers and actual to expected analyses.
This position will report to the AVP, Reinsurance Controller and will work closely with members of the Finance, Institutional, and other functional areas as necessary. The role currently has no direct reports and will be based in the Cayman Islands.
